Let's try some troubleshooting steps to see if we can resolve the issue. First, I recommend rebooting the device by shutting it down entirely, then turning it back on and trying Pandora again. If you're still having issues, try uninstalling and reinstalling the app (not to worry, we'll keep track of your profile and collection for you).* To do that:
Hold down the Pandora icon on your Home screen until all the icons start "shaking."
Then tap - in the upper left of the Pandora icon, and confirm that you want to Delete app.
Then re-install Pandora via the App Store on your device.
